Transaction 1dbe062843d84c86959143345358a7ac6df9a2e16fee2909dd40b1166fd9ff39

block
802396c67d4b399e98546fac9bb8e64bbb0b36e5c3e73a20c237df6023f4641e

1 Input

27 Outputs